Fans of TikTok are discussing how to fall asleep faster. Some suggest that wearing socks keeps the toes warm and creates a sense of comfort and coziness. At the same time, the temperature of other parts of the body decreases. Although there is a lack of high-quality research on how wearing socks can help lower body temperature, there is a commonly accepted theoretical explanation. Most sleep experts agree that people tend to sleep better when they are cool. The National Sleep Foundation recommends maintaining an ambient temperature between 60 and 67 degrees Fahrenheit while sleeping. However, this is a broad range and depends on the individual, experts say. A 2023 study indicates that for older people, sleep is “most efficient and restful” when the temperature ranges between 68 and 77 degrees. Our bodies also help us stay cool at night. Body temperature — averaging around 98.6 degrees Fahrenheit — is regulated by the circadian rhythm and tends to fluctuate slightly throughout the day and night. Research shows that our body temperature is lowest around 4 a.m., then gradually rises throughout the day, peaking in the evening before bedtime. According to medical experts, sweating can lower body temperature, as can distal vasodilation — a process where small blood vessels under the skin widen, allowing heat to escape. When we warm our feet by wearing socks, blood vessels under the skin dilate not just in the feet but throughout the body, doctors claim. This vasodilation allows warm blood to reach the surface, and as it continues to circulate and reach the skin, body heat dissipates, causing the body’s core temperature to eventually drop. It’s this decrease in body temperature that signals the brain to prepare for sleep, specialists conclude.
